First, let me start by saying I do vote. Sometimes the candidate I vote for wins but most times they don't. Every two years I get a slight feeling that I would rather live where there is a benevolent dictator in charge, but I doubt that place exists. The primaries here in Florida are in late August and by now every street corner is littered with little signs that basically say "vote for me and I will get you everything you want". The candidates rarely discuss matters that they have any control over. It's all about getting elected. The only people who benefit from this madness are the advertising agencies. Plus my mailbox every day is full of little to big postcards saying the same thing that the signs along the roadways do. I am promising myself that this year I will take my absentee ballot and sit in front of my computer to learn as much as I can about each candidate. Those who have their dog included in the required campaign photo will be rejected immediately. Those who promise everything will get eliminated as well as those who say nothing about everything will get eliminated probably leaving a very short list of candidates to choose between. Then, after the election results are in I will see how many of the candidates I voted for actually won.

Gov. Rick Perry of Texas Is Indicted on Charge of Abuse of Power

AUSTIN, Tex. — A grand jury indicted Gov. Rick Perry on two felony counts on Friday, charging that he abused his power last year when he tried to pressure the district attorney here, a Democrat, to step down by threatening to cut off state financing to her office.
